@charset "UTF-8";.search__product-types .custom-select,custom-select#product_types,.cc-promo-strip{display:none!important}body .search--product-types .search__input{background:#fff;color:#b85750;padding-left:40px;border:1px solid grey}body .search--product-types .search__input::placeholder{color:#b85750}.search__input ::placeholder{color:#b85750}.container{width:100%;max-width:100%}.main-menu{background:#3d5361;padding:10px!important;display:block}a#view-cart-button{position:absolute;z-index:9;width:auto;right:10%;color:#b85750;display:block;text-decoration:underline}.product-info__add-button{position:relative}.cc-header--sticky .main-menu__disclosure{background:inherit;padding:0 var(--gutter)}.header__icon,.search__speech{color:#b85750}div#shopify-block-AaUt4OFR3MTcwUDk0T__db5a87e1-4b9a-4442-8c56-8688ab70f5c3{background:none}a.header__icon.text-current,a.header__icon.text-current.account{flex-direction:row;width:auto;height:auto}.header__icon.account>.icon{width:25px;height:25px;margin-left:5px}a.header__icon.text-current.eos-trade-header{border-radius:var(--btn-border-radius, 0);border:1px solid #B85750;font-weight:700;background-size:300% 300%;padding:6px 20px}.customCollectionBlock .color-scheme--transparent{padding-top:0;padding-bottom:0;margin-top:0}.customCollectionBlock ul{grid-auto-rows:1fr;align-items:stretch}.customCollectionBlock ul>li:first-child{grid-column:span 2;max-height:80vh;overflow:hidden}.customCollectionBlock ul>li:first-child .card{max-height:inherit;max-width:100%}.customCollectionBlock ul>li:first-child .card__collection .media{padding-top:64%!important}.customCollectionLinks .card__info.relative.text-center{position:absolute;top:85%;text-align:center;width:100%}.customCollectionLinks .card__info.relative.text-center a{background:#efe6e1;padding:10px 30px;border-radius:30px;font-size:14px;text-transform:uppercase}.customCollectionLinks{margin-bottom:0;margin-top:30px}.cc-header--sticky .header.is-out .main-menu__disclosure{max-height:100%;margin-top:auto}body .search__speech{color:#b85750}.main-nav__child.mega-nav,.main-nav__child.has-motion{background:#3d5361}body .facets.drawer{max-width:100%}.tablist__tab,h3.predictive-result__title.h6,button.predictive-search__view-all.link.w-full.text-start.focus-inset.has-ltr-icon.js-search-link,.predictive-search__no-results{color:#000!important}.product-info__block.product-options label[data-swatch],.filter__label[data-swatch]:before{overflow:visible}.product-info__block.product-options fieldset.option-selector{padding-bottom:19px}.product-info__block.product-options label[data-swatch] span{font-weight:400;font-size:14px;padding-top:5px;display:block;position:static!important;width:auto!important;height:auto!important;padding:initial!important;margin:4px 0 0!important;overflow:visible!important;clip:auto!important;white-space:normal!important;border-width:initial!important}.benchtop-selection h6{font-size:.88em;font-weight:700;color:#000}.facets__filters{display:flex;justify-content:space-between;flex-wrap:wrap;align-items:center;width:100%;gap:15px;padding:10px 0}details-disclosure{min-width:250px}.facets__filters details,.facets.drawer{flex:1;background:#f5f5f5;padding:12px;border-radius:8px;text-align:center;cursor:pointer;transition:all .3s ease-in-out}.cc-newsletter .input-with-button>.input::placeholder{color:#eed3cc}.cc-newsletter .input-with-button>.btn:not(.btn--primary){color:#000}.cc-newsletter .input-with-button>.btn:not(.btn--primary){background:#fff;font-size:18px}.cc-newsletter .input-with-button:focus-within{box-shadow:none}.cc-newsletter .input-with-button>.input{margin:20px;color:#eed3cc;border-radius:0;border-bottom:1px solid #eed3cc;padding-left:0}.cc-newsletter .input-with-button{background:none;color:#eed3cc;border:none;box-shadow:none}.facets__filters details-disclosure.md\:hidden.no-js-visible{display:block}.shopify-section.cc-collection-banner.section.section--template{margin:-10px 0 10px}.main-products-grid .card{background:#fff;padding:20px}.header__cart-count{background:#b85750}.benchtop-products{display:flex;gap:0px;overflow-x:auto;padding-bottom:0;margin-left:-10px}.benchtop-item{display:flex;flex-direction:column;align-items:center;text-align:center;min-width:100px;text-decoration:none}.benchtop-item img{width:80px;height:80px;object-fit:cover;border-radius:5px;transition:transform .2s}.benchtop-item img:hover{transform:scale(1.1)}.benchtop-item p{font-size:14px;margin-top:5px;color:#333;width:100px}.footer-block__btns .btn.btn--primary{background:none;border:none;text-align:left;padding:0;text-decoration:underline;font-weight:400}.customopupcolor h3{font-size:20px;text-align:left;border-bottom:1px solid #B85750;padding-bottom:10px}.customopupcolor .subcategory-list{list-style:none;margin:0;padding:0;display:flex;gap:.5rem}.subcategories-section{margin-bottom:20px;margin-top:15px}.customopupcolor .subcategory-list li a img{max-width:110px;height:auto}.customopupcolor .subcategory-list li a span{display:grid;font-size:13px}.shopify-section.cc-newsletter .separatorBorderNewsletter span{border-bottom:1px solid #eed3cc;max-width:1200px;display:block;margin:0 auto}.shopify-section.cc-apps.section .container .shopify-app-block .sc-z7sjip-1.ffMEuv.reputon-static-plate{background:#fff;padding:10px}.sc-1kplsbh-1.tbbxw.reputon-static-plate-container{padding:0 20px}body .reputon-google-reviews-widget .eypJMc{display:block}.shopify-section.cc-newsletter .newsletter{background:#3d5361;padding:10px 0;margin:0}.shopify-section.cc-newsletter .section__block:last-child{top:40px}.shopify-section.cc-newsletter .newsletter h2,.shopify-section.cc-newsletter .newsletter p{color:#eed3cc}.nosearchresultsblock{text-align:center}.shopify-section.cc-newsletter .separatorBorderNewsletter{background:#3d5361}a.btn.btn--primary.mainCTAContact{background:#b85750;border:1px solid #b85750;margin-bottom:12px}.footer-block__btns .btn.btn--primary{font-size:16px}.footer__main.md\:flex.md\:flex-wrap.mb-10.md\:mb-6{margin-bottom:0}.footer__hr{margin:10px}span.font-heading.collection-banner__count.block.items-center.text-center{display:none}.product-options .option-selector__btns{row-gap:40px}.filter__label[data-swatch],.disclosure>summary{text-align:left}div#insta-feed h2{color:rgb(var(--heading-color));font-size:var(--h4-font-size);line-height:1.3;font-family:var(--heading-font-family)}.speech-search--failed .search__reset,.search__reset.text-current.vertical-center.absolute.focus-inset.js-search-reset{color:#b85750!important}.predictive-result.predictive-result--suggestion{color:#000}.product-info__block div#bigpost-widget{display:none}.cc-main-page h1.page__title.lg\:mt-8.text-center{margin-top:-25px!important;margin-bottom:-10px!important}.cc-main-page p.MsoNormal{margin-bottom:10px}.footer .container{max-width:1300px}h1.product-title.h5.customtitle span.subtitle{display:block;color:rgb(var(--text-color));font-family:var(--body-font-family);font-size:calc(var(--body-font-size) * .1rem);font-style:var(--body-font-style);font-weight:var(--body-font-weight);line-height:1.5}@media(min-width:1024px){products-toolbar#products-toolbar.new-class{position:fixed;top:160px;z-index:1;width:100%;margin:0 auto;left:0;padding:0 100px;background-color:rgba(var(--bg-color))}details#filter-sort{display:none}}@media(max-width:1024px){.facets__filters{flex-wrap:wrap}.facets__filters details{max-width:45%}}@media(min-width:769px){.customopupcolor.popup-section .modal__window{width:100%}.footer{padding:10px}.customopupcolor.popup-section .modal__content--p-large{padding:calc(16* var(--space-unit)) 20px}}@media(max-width:768px){.facets__filters{flex-direction:column;align-items:stretch}.facets__filters details{max-width:100%}body .main-menu__content{background:#3d5361}body .customCollectionLinks .card__info.relative.text-center{top:73%;padding:10px}.customCollectionLinks .card__info.relative.text-center a{padding:10px;font-size:12px}body #shopify-section-template--24390062014754__media_with_text_gRDzVi img.img-fit{max-width:400px;margin-left:0}body .reputon-google-reviews-widget .JZPEU{border-radius:none}.newsletter .input-with-button{display:block}.header{padding-bottom:0!important}.reputon-google-reviews-widget .JZPEU{margin-top:10px}.cc-newsletter .input-with-button>.input{width:80%}body #shopify-section-template--24390062014754__image-banner img.img-fit{padding:0}a#view-cart-button{margin-left:50px;margin-top:-35px}}@media(max-width:480px){#filter-results a#view-cart-button{margin-left:0;margin-top:0}#shopify-section-template--24390062014754__image-banner .image-banner{margin-top:30px;height:auto!important;margin-left:var(--gutter);margin-right:var(--gutter)}}
/*# sourceMappingURL=/cdn/shop/t/15/assets/custom.css.map */
